Safety Training

Cal/OSHA requires that every employer shall establish, implement and maintain an effective Injury and Illness Prevention Program (“Program”), the Program shall be in writing, and shall at a minimum provide training and instruction to all new employees.

Cal/OSHA also requires that all new employees also receive training and instruction for the hazards likely to be encountered on the job as well as mandatory safety training on a variety of other subjects.

For a high-hazard industry, like the construction industry, Cal/OSHA requires that every jobsite have a person certified in CPR/First Aid who will be present at the job site at all times.
